The Sting of Jealousy: Unpacking 'Cachetada' by La Barra
La Barra's song 'Cachetada' delves deep into the raw and painful emotions of jealousy and unrequited love. The lyrics paint a vivid picture of a person who is tormented by the sight of their beloved in the arms of another. The repeated use of the word 'cachetada,' which translates to 'slap' in English, serves as a powerful metaphor for the emotional pain and betrayal felt by the protagonist. Each affectionate gesture between the beloved and their new partner feels like a physical blow, highlighting the intensity of the protagonist's anguish.
The song's narrative is driven by the protagonist's obsessive behavior, as they admit to following their beloved 'like a dog' in hopes of catching them alone. This imagery underscores the desperation and helplessness that often accompany unreciprocated feelings. The protagonist's jealousy is palpable, as they confess to being unable to bear the sight of their beloved being happy with someone else. The lyrics convey a sense of longing and frustration, as the protagonist wishes for the beloved to leave their current partner and return to them.
'Cachetada' also explores the theme of self-torment, as the protagonist acknowledges that their thoughts are betraying them. The internal conflict is evident as they grapple with their desire to replace the new partner and reclaim their beloved's affection. The song's emotional intensity is further amplified by the vivid descriptions of the protagonist's physical and emotional reactions to the beloved's interactions with their new partner. The repeated refrain of 'es una cachetada' serves as a poignant reminder of the protagonist's suffering, making 'Cachetada' a powerful exploration of the darker side of love and jealousy.
